SANCTA SUSANNA To Have West Coast Premiere At Heritage Square Museum

Source/Filter Music Collective will present the West Coast premiere of Paul Hindemith's Sancta Susanna, an immersive, site-specific horror opera production set for October 24th and 25th at Heritage Square Museum's historic Lincoln Avenue Church.

This daring production transforms the church into a secluded convent where an innocent nun, Susanna, grapples with disturbing satanic visions. As she seeks comfort from her mother superior, Susanna uncovers a dark and sinister secret hidden within the convent's walls. Inspired by cult horror films like Dario Argento's Suspiria and Ken Russell's The Devils, this immersive experience promises a chilling night that will challenge the boundaries of opera and horror.

Audiences will also be treated to a haunting choral performance by our evil nun chorus, featuring atmospheric works by composers such as Benjamin Britten, Nadia Boulanger, and Hildegard von Bingen. The night will end with a Halloween dance party, where a live DJ will spin spooky hits. Costumes are highly encouraged.

ABOUT SOURCE/FILTER MUSIC COLLECTIVE:

Founded in 2022, Source/Filter Music Collective is a group of Los Angeles and Pasadena artists dedicated to producing unique musical projects that spotlight local composers and performers. The collective is committed to creating immersive, cinematic musical experiences that elevate underrepresented voices onstage and behind the scenes.
